[摘要]北京CBD文化設(shè)施采用鋼框架-支撐結(jié)構(gòu)體系,設(shè)計難點主要為大跨度、大懸挑及樓板開大洞等。采用ABAQUS軟件進行建模,并利用ABAQUS軟件的瞬態(tài)動力學分析技術(shù)對此結(jié)構(gòu)進行了彈性時程分析與彈塑性時程分析,分析了結(jié)構(gòu)在多遇地震與罕遇地震作用下的時程響應。計算結(jié)果表明,結(jié)構(gòu)的各項指標均滿足規(guī)范要求。

Abstract:Beijing CBD Cultural Center adopts braced-steel-frame structural system. Difficulty in design mainly results from large-spans, large-cantilever spans and large-openings in the floor system. The transient dynamic analysis technique of ABAQUS software was used to develop a 3-dimensional finite element model for undertaking elastic time-history analyses under frequent earthquakes and elasto-plastic time-history analyses under rare earthquakes. Calculation results show that all structural indexes can meet code requirements.
